So from a sample size of one, I've never broken a keyboard on a full height key, I've broken 3-4 on laptop butterfly keyboards over the last 20-ish years, and I've broke one on a G915 in one year. I mean just look at the underside of the logitech keycaps with two thin prongs versus the heavier duty (and redundant points of connection) on the female + connector on a cherry key, I know which I'd bet on. |
